Step 1: Prep the Chicken
First things first, let’s get that chicken ready. You’ll want to use bo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s, whichever you prefer for your chicken buttered noodles. Here’s how to prepare it:
- Start by trimming any excess fat from the chicken. This not only promotes better flavor but also a healthier meal.
- Next, c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ces. This helps them cook faster and ensures everyone gets a piece in each serving.
- Season the chicken pieces generously with salt, pepper, and any other spices you love—think garlic powder, paprika, or Italian seasoning to elevate the flavor.

Step 2: Boil the Noodles
While you’re prepping the chicken, it’s a great time to also start boiling your noodles. Choose your favorite type—egg noodles or fettuccine work beautifully here. Here’s how to do it:
- In a large pot, bring water to a rolling boil. Add a generous pinch of salt to enhance the pasta flavor.
- Once boiling, toss in the noodles and cook them according to package instructions until they’re al dente. This usually takes around 7-10 minutes.
- After cooking, drain the noodles and leave them in the colander for a moment. Avoid rinsing, as you want that starch to help the sauce cling later.

Step 3: Create the Butter Sauce
Now comes the magic—making the buttery sauce that ties everything together. Here’s what you’ll need to do:
- In a large skillet, melt a couple of tablespoons of butter over medium heat. You can add an equal amount of olive oil for extra richness and flavor.
- Once the butter is melted, toss in minced garlic (about 2-3 cloves, depending on your love for garlic) and let it cook until fragrant, which should take about 30 seconds.
- If you’re feeling adventurous, add some diced turkey bacon or chicken ham at this stage for an additional flavor boost! Cook for a few minutes until they’re crispy and well-integrated with the garlic.
Step 4: Combine Ingredients
With the sauce ready, it’s time to bring the chicken buttered noodles together:
- Add the seasoned chicken pieces to the skillet and cook until they’re golden brown and cooked through (around 5–7 minutes).
- Once the chicken is done, add the cooked noodles to the skillet. Toss everything gently to coat the noodles in that luscious butter sauce.
- If the mixture looks a bit dry, feel free to add a splash of chicken broth or even a touch of cream for extra indulgence.
Step 5: Final Touches before Serving
Before you serve up your chicken buttered noodles, take a moment to add those finishing touches:
- Sprinkle some freshly grated Parmesan cheese over your dish. Not only does it enhance the flavor, but it also adds a touch of elegance.
- Garnish with freshly chopped parsley or basil for a pop of color and freshness.
- Serve hot and enjoy the comforting embrace of your homemade meal.

Mastering the Perfect Butter Sauce
The butter sauce is key to delicious chicken buttered noodles. Start by using unsalted butter to control the saltiness, allowing the flavors of garlic and herbs to shine. Sauté minced garlic in the melted butter until fragrant, but be careful not to let it brown; burnt garlic can give a bitter taste that muddles your dish. For an extra touch, consider adding a splash of chicken broth or a hint of lemon juice for acidity. This enhances the richness and elevates your sauce to a whole new level.
How to Avoid Overcooking the Chicken
Overcooked chicken can turn your meal from delightful to dry. To keep your chicken juicy, it’s best to use bo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s, which cook faster and remain tender. Aim for an internal temperature of 165°F—using a meat thermometer can eliminate guesswork. When you see a golden-brown crust forming, it’s usually time to check. Don’t forget to let the chicken rest for a few minutes before slicing; this helps the juices redistribute and keeps each bite moist.

PrintChicken Buttered Noodles: Easy Comfort Food with Turkey Bacon
A delicious and comforting chicken buttered noodle recipe that incorporates turkey bacon for added flavor.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Main Dish
- Method: Stovetop
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Gluten Free
Ingredients
- 8 ounces egg noodles
- 4 tablespoons butter
- 2 chicken breasts, cooked and shredded
- 4 slices turkey bacon, cooked and chopped
- 1/2 cup chicken broth
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/4 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
Instructions
- In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ook the egg noodles according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
- In the same pot, melt the butter over medium heat.
- Add the shredded chicken and turkey bacon to the pot and sauté for a few minutes until heated through.
- Pour in the chicken broth and season with black p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Stir well.
- Add the cooked noodles to the pot and toss to combine.
- Remove from heat and stir in the Parmesan cheese and chopped parsley before serving.
Notes
- For a richer flavor, you can add more butter or cheese as desired.
- This dish pairs well with a side salad for a complete meal.
